About this Client Success Coordinator (Health System Partnerships) role at Getmaple
Maple's purpose is to meet the world's healthcare needs. We're Canada's leading on-demand healthcare platform, connecting patients with Canadian-licensed doctors, nurse practitioners and specialists. Today, we're proud that over 8 million patients and 7,000 businesses and government partners have access to same-day, proactive and ongoing care. The role
Your responsibilities
As a Client Success Coordinator, you will:
Coordinate partner meetings end-to-end — support agenda and meeting preparation, actively participate, capture and track action items, and follow up until they're closed
Own recurring partner reporting workflows, including preparing reports from automated and manual sources and surfacing relevant insights to the HSP team
Process and review manual partner eligibility files on the required cadence and support the resolution of eligibility issues
Serve as the primary connector between HSP and Provider Network Operations on provider-related matters and triaging provider-related partner questions to the right internal team
Maintain accurate partner information our CRM (Salesforce) and keep partner-specific program documentation current so partner-facing teams can operate consistently
Maintain shared HSP documentation, templates, playbooks and SOPs, and support onboarding of new HSP team members by coordinating the operational components of onboarding
Provide day-to-day partner support by troubleshooting and coordinating escalated issues, including eligibility support for Maple's Customer Support Team and partner-raised questions
Collect, organize and share partner and patient feedback with the HSP team so themes can be actioned by the right owner
Support HSP Client Success Associates and Client Success Managers on process-improvement initiatives that reduce administrative burden and create capacity across the broader team
What success looks like
In your first 90 days, you'll build a strong foundation in Maple's tools, systems and each of the HSP team's partner programs. You'll establish working relationships with the Provider Network Operations team and get fluent in how HSP and Provider Network Operations collaborate day-to-day, including the escalation model. You'll take ownership of core partner and meeting support workflows, and start actively contributing to partner meetings — preparing agendas, participating, and tracking action items through to close.
Over your first 12–18 months, you'll become a subject-matter expert on how HSP and Provider Network Operations work together, making sure partner-specific nuances are consistently represented. You'll deliver at least one meaningful team enablement improvement — a streamlined admin process, template or playbook — that reduces operational burden across the HSP team, and you'll provide the reliable coordination and administrative support Client Success Associates and Client Success Managers need as the portfolio grows across existing and new partnerships.
What you bring
At least one year of experience in a client-facing role — for example, client success, account coordination, customer support or account management
An undergraduate degree in business, health administration, public health, communications or a related field, or equivalent professional experience
Strong written and verbal communication skills — you're clear, concise and professional in every partner-facing interaction, comfortable representing Maple in meetings with government and health system partners, and able to adapt your tone for different audiences
Active listening and timely follow-through — you catch what matters in a conversation and close the loop through well-organized written work (email, meeting notes, reports)
A proactive, highly organized way of working — you own your day, stay on top of the details and move things forward without needing to be chased
A strong eye for detail across documents, data and processes
Comfort collaborating across teams to keep context, questions and escalations flowing cleanly between groups
A technology self-starter who picks up new platforms quickly — including AI tools — and helps others adopt them
Confidence working in Google Workspace (Docs, Sheets and Slides)
